Prep Time 12 minutes
Serving Size 4 people

Ingredients

Jerusalem Salad Ingredients:

For the Jerusalem Salad:

  • 2 large tomatoes diced (about 2 cups or 300g)
  • 1 cucumber diced (about 1.5 cups or 200g)
  • 1 red onion finely chopped (about 1 cup or 150g)
  • 1 bell pepper any color, diced (about 1 cup or 150g)

For the Jerusalem salad Dressing:

  • 3 tablespoons (45ml) extra-virgin olive oil
  • 2 tablespoons (30ml) freshly squeezed lemon juice
  • 2 cloves garlic minced
  • 1 teaspoon ground cumin
  • 1/3 teaspoon Sal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on Ground Black Pepper

Optional Garnish:

  • 1 bunch Fresh parsley chopped
  • 1 handful Mint leaves chopped

Instructions

How to make easy vegan salad from Israel Instructions:

    Prepare Vegetables:

    • Wash and dice the tomatoes, cucumber, red onion, and bell pepper. Place them in a large salad bowl.

    Make the Dressing:

    • In a small bowl, whisk together the olive oil, lemon juice, minced garlic, ground cumin, salt, and pepper. Adjust the seasoning to taste.

    Combine Salad and Dressing:

    • Pour the dressing over the diced vegetables in the salad bowl. Gently toss until the vegetables are well coated with the dressing.

    Optional Garnish:

    • Sprinkle chopped fresh parsley and mint leaves over the salad for added freshness and flavor.

    Chill and Serve:

    • Refrigerate the salad for at least 30 minutes to allow the flavors to meld. Serve chilled.
    • Enjoy your authentic Jerusalem Salad! This vibrant and refreshing dish is a perfect complement to a variety of meals or a light, standalone option. Adjust the ingredients and seasonings to your liking for a personalized touch.

    Notes

    Store leftover Jerusalem Salad in an airtight container in the refrigerator. Consume it within 1-2 days for the best quality. Keep in mind that the salad may release some liquid over time, so a quick toss before serving can refresh it.
